3.0 TFSI Airbox Cover and Intake Help/Questions
 
I posted this over in the q7 specific discussion, but its been crickets over there. Simple answer would be to buy a new airbox cover, but not sure I want to do that if all I need to do is seal this off.

This is what I posted over in the q7 discussion.
I'm working my way through some maintenance on a new to us '12 Q7 with the 3.0 TFSI. While I was cleaning out the airbox when replacing the air filter I noticed something awry/broken with the Airbox Cover. It seems there is this protrusion that appears as though it would have a line connect to it that is open to unfiltered air, yet its on the clean side of the air box. So basically its letting a small amount of unfiltered air in, which isn't great. It does appear as though something "broke" off this end, as its not a clean flat surface at the tip. I've attached some pictures below. Also if anyone knows what this random clip on the air intake tube is, i'd love to know.
